Infineon’s BRIGHTLANE™ automotive Ethernet PHY family sets the benchmark for high-performance, scalable, and future-ready in-vehicle networking. Supporting the most extensive range of Ethernet standards, including 10GBASE-T1, 5GBASE-T1, 2.5GBASE-T1, 1000BASE-T1, 100BASE-T1, 1000BASE-T, 100BASE-TX, and 10BASE-T, BRIGHTLANE™ Ethernet PHY ICs (integrated chips) ensure high-performance connectivity for advanced zonal vehicle architectures.

Built on a standard digital CMOS process, BRIGHTLANE™ automotive PHY solutions comply with global Ethernet standards, including IEEE 802.3ch (2.5G/5G/10GBASE-T1), IEEE 802.3bp (1000BASE-T1), and IEEE 802.3bw (100BASE-T1). All multi-gigabit PHYs deliver high-speed data transmission and contain the active circuitry required to implement the physical layer functions on a single balanced twisted-pair cable, enabling reduced wiring complexity. Its robust design ensures seamless operation across electronic control units, cameras, sensors, and controllers, supporting the data backbone required for connected vehicles.

The BRIGHTLANE™ Ethernet PHY family is optimized for low power consumption, automotive-grade reliability, and compliance with AEC-Q100 standards. This makes it the ideal solution for a wide range of applications, from ADAS and Infotainment systems to Zonal controllers.

The BRIGHTLANE™ automotive Ethernet PHY portfolio supports network speeds from 100 Mbps to 10 Gbps, meaning these multi-gigabit Ethernet PHY systems offer optimal speed and reliability.

Our portfolio of Ethernet PHY transceivers and chips boast the following features:

  • 2.5G/5G/10GBASE-T1, IEEE 802.3ch-compliant
  • 1000BASE-T1, IEEE 802.3bp-compliant
  • 100BASE-T1, IEEE 802.3bw-compliant
  • RGMII / SGMII to Copper
  • Supports OPEN Alliance TC10
  • Supports IEEE 802.1AE MACsec
  •  Supports 802.1AS – precision time protocol (PTP)
  • MDC/MDIO management interface eliminate passive components
  • Integrated voltage regulations
